Can someone help me calculate the smallest change in weight I will be able to read with the cfp-sg-140 and a 10 lbs load cell with a 10 volt excitation and 3mV/V output. I know this module is 16 bit 2^16, but how do I translate this to pounds or grams??? How about if I use a 5 lbs load cell??

Just do the math.
You would need the 3.5 mV range for a 3 mV/V input. 1/2^16 x 3.5 mV/V is 1 part in 65536 is .0534 microvolts/V
Take that times 10lbs divided by 3 mV/V = 1.78 e-4 lbs
